What are Bose Sleepbuds?
Before we dive into the nitty-gritty of charging time and battery life, let’s take a closer look at what Bose Sleepbuds are and how they work. Bose Sleepbuds are tiny, wireless earbuds designed specifically for sleep. They’re not meant for listening to music or podcasts, but rather for masking background noise that can disrupt your sleep.
These earbuds use a unique technology called noise-masking, which involves playing soothing sounds that cover up other noises that might be keeping you awake. The sounds are designed to be calming and relaxing, helping you fall asleep faster and sleep more soundly.
